Nickel and Dimed: On (Not) Getting By in America

Book Image

By Barbara Ehrenreich — 2011

Millions of Americans work full time, year round, for poverty-level wages. In 1998, Barbara Ehrenreich decided to join them. She was inspired in part by the rhetoric surrounding welfare reform, which promised that a job―any job―can be the ticket to a better life. See more...
